MOUNTAIN VIEW, Calif.
-(Jan. 16, 2001 )-- Pinnacle Systems, Inc. announced that it has acquired
DVD authoring technology from Minerva Networks, Inc. Technology acquired
from Minerva Networks includes the Impression family of DVD application
software, DVD formatting software and associated intellectual property.
Pinnacle
Systems plans to integrate this DVD software technology with its family
of industry leading content creation solutions to provide easy-to-use
DVD authoring solutions compatible with emerging low-cost DVD-R and
DVD-R/W drives.
Bill Loesch, vice president of new business development at Pinnacle
Systems said, "This acquisition will allow Pinnacle Systems to extend
its strong position in the video content creation market by incorporating
DVD authoring for consumers and professionals in these solutions. We
believe that as a result of recent developments in low-cost DVD-R and
DVD-R/W drives, this market is poised for significant growth" .
"Customers will benefit from this transfer of technology," said
Patrick Sweeney, VP of Marketing at Minerva Networks. "Minerva
can continue our rapid growth in the IP Television market while our
loyal customers will benefit from the focus Pinnacle Systems will add
to the DVD product line."
